If you want to install fonts in X: what kind of fonts? - X can use
nearly any PostScript font and certain bitmap fonts.
It's easy to install e.g. Type-1 fonts in X, but - unlike with
windows or mac - this does not mean, that every application will
then automatically be ready to use these fonts. What application are
you planning to use for displaying and printing the fonts?
Will you be using PostScript- or non-PostScript printers to print
the fonts? - If you're using non-PS printers, you'll need a printer
filter program (e.g. ghostscript) to print them, and that filter
needs to have access to the font files...
(But it works!)
